Common Questions and Answers
What is an Optical Low Pass Filter, and why do I need one?
An Optical Low Pass Filter is designed to reduce aliasing by softening high-frequency light signals. If you're working in photography or videography, an OLPF can enhance the quality of your images by preventing moiré patterns and improving detail rendering.
